2026 TalkRob Draper is a British artist and designer celebrated for his distinctive approach to creativity. His expertise in hand-lettering has earned global recognition, leading to collaborations with an impressive international client list—including The Golden Globes, Meta, NASA/JPL, Nike, Gap, Levi’s, Samsung, Penguin, Pentagram, Gumball 3000, Sunglass Hut, and WWF. His work has been widely featured in international press, from IdN International Designers Network and Design Taxi to The Design Museum London, High Fructose, Meta, and The Daily Mail. He has also been published in numerous books on art, design, and creativity.
When Rob’s dream job vanished overnight, he faced a choice: start over or take a leap into the unknown. Instead of walking away from 20+ years in design, he chose uncertainty—saying yes to everything and seeing where it led. The result - Unexpected detours, from working in a high-security prison to sketching on coffee cups in his spare time.
Even after achieving some dreams, life reset again—back to square one, living on a camp bed in his sister’s front room. And when ‘that’ global pandemic wiped out his work, he had no choice but to rebuild from scratch - this time, with nothing but a shed, limited materials, and an audience watching online.
Through every twist, one thing became clear: creativity thrives on constraints. His journey is proof that obstacles can be opportunities, starting small is enough, and imperfection is where the best ideas begin.
